Hi all, I am hoping that you can help!! Myself and DH are celebrating a significant anniversary this Summer and would like to take a holiday sans the 3 kids. Two DD (12 and 15) and one DS (17) are left without parents for two weeks. DS is insisting that he could stay at home or with friends but I am nervous about leaving him.
I could send the girls on Summer camp, they attended one in the UK a few years back and loved it but ideally I would like to know that all three are occupied and none of them seem keen on spending two weeks with Gran in Nottingham Wink

Has anyone any recommendations? Or reassuring stories of leaving a 17 year old at home alone!?

If you trust him, I can't see any reason why you couldn't leave a 17 yo alone at home. Have you spoken to him about it? After all in less than a year's time he might be off to Uni (or work, or whatever). He's basically an adult.

We left our DD17 for a week at Easter this year and last year and she was fine. We prepared some back up from GPs but this fell through due to illness so she was mostly home alone. The week was a mix of friends staying over, visiting friends and being home alone. My main concern was her being lonely and I think a week was long enough. She looked positively pleased to see us when we returned though she would never admit it!
If you do decide on leaving him for two weeks perhaps you could structure the time so he had a few nights with Gran or a few nights fixed with guests staying or at a festival or something else he might like.
My main concern would be them feeling a bit lonely rather than any trust or capability issues.
